c语言pt_,C语言PT课件-数据类型、运算符、表达式.ppt

C语言PT课件-数据类型、运算符、表达式

2000年1月25日 北京理工大学 / §基本语句 main( ) 标志 { 花括号 int a=5,b=6,S;说明语句 s=a*b; 公式(赋值语句) printf(“s=%d”,s); 打印语句 }只要掌握三条语句就可以编程了 §基本语句 1、说明语句 2、赋值语句 3、printf(“s=%d”,s); 打印语句(输出语句) 今天我们要讲的是这三条语句的使用。 §基本语句 1、说明语句 1、说明语句 int a=5,b=6,S; main( ) {int a=5,b=6,S; 说明语句 s=a*b; printf(“s=%d”,s); } 花括号内第一条语句必须是说明语句! 说明语句是程序内第条语句。 §3.1 数据类型 §3.1 说明语句 §3.1 数据类型 §3.1 数据类型 §3.1 字符型的应用 §3.1 程序如下 §3-2 变量 a,b,s. 补充一个概念:变量 main() { int a=5,b=6,s; s=a*b; printf(“s=%d”,s);} 在程序中,已知量a,b,未知量s我们都称这为变量。 §3-2 变量 变量的值允许改变,指的是在程序中,根据需要,变量的值可以改变它的值。 例子: 分别计算 a=5,b=6和 a=7,b=8两个长方形的面积。 程序如下: main() { int a=5,b=6,s; a,b第1次给的值 s=a*b; 计算第一个面积s printf(“s1=%d ”,s); a=7,b=8; a,b第2次给的值 s=a*b; 计算第二个面积s printf(“s2=%d ”,s); } 结果 :s1=30 s2=56 §基本语句 2、赋值语句 2、赋值语句 例: a=5; b=20; s=a*b; v=a+b; 赋值语句 在 C 程序中,“=”号表示给值或赋值: a=5 ;b=6; 表示将数字 5 赋值给变量 a .数字 6 赋值给变量 b . ”=“ 叫做赋值号. 赋值语句 所以赋值号“ =” 的左边只能是变量 变量=值(或表达式); § 赋值语句 k=123; /* 将整数123赋给变量K */ c1=‘A‘ /* 将字符A赋给变量C1 */ a=123.3; /* 将实数123.23赋给变量a */ b=a+k+6; /* 表达式的值赋给变量b */ § 2-1-3 字 符 型 数 据 实例、向字符变量赋值 main() {char c1,c2; /*说明c1,c2为字符变量*/ c1=‘a’; /*c1=“a”*/ c2=‘b’; /*c2=“b”*/ printf(“%c %c/n”,c1,c2); } 输出结果: a b §2-3 赋值语句 注意: “=”左边必须是变量名。如: 5=2+3 是错误的。 b+2=6*2 是错误的。 应改为: a=2+3; b=6*2-2; §2-3 赋值语句 注意:在程序中赋值语句的顺序。已知量必须先赋值。否则结果不可预测 例如: main() { int a,b,s; a=2;b=3; s=a*b; printf(“%d”,s);} §2-3 赋值语句 如果顺序变成下面。结果不可预测 例如: main() { int a,b,s; s=a*b; a=2;b=3; printf(“%d”,s);} §基本语句 3、打印(输出)语句 §4-2 数据的输出 数据的输出 我们前面讲过的语句 printf() 在C里实际称为输出函数。它的格式为 Printf(“控制格式“,变量表) §4-2 数据的输入与输出 控制格式—用来标明变量的类型 d – 整数输出 f – 实数输出 c – 字符输出 s – 字符串输出 §4-2 数据的输入与输

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值